A quadtree does the same thing for two-dimensional space. It takes a rectangular region and divides it into four equal quadrants: northwest, northeast, southwest, southeast. Rotom is not, in and of itself, a living inanimate object. It's more like a living spark of electricity. It has no evolutionary tree, but it does learn to inhabit a variety of household objects, gaining different abilities.
